Taxonomic Classification

Rank Agile Gibbon Juniper Groundling
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Primates (Primates)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ths)
Family Hylobatidae Gelechiidae
Genus Hylobates Gelechia
Species Hylobates agilis Gelechia sabinellus

Evolutionary Relationship

Agile Gibbon and Juniper Groundling share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
